Foundation Damage Repair services focus on addressing issues related to the stability and integrity of a building’s foundation. These services typically involve inspecting the foundation to identify signs of damage, such as cracks, settling, or uneven flooring, and then implementing appropriate repair methods. Common techniques include underpinning, slab jacking, piering, and the installation of support beams to stabilize the structure. The goal is to restore the foundation’s strength and prevent further deterioration, ensuring the safety and longevity of the property.
Problems that foundation damage repair services help resolve often stem from soil movement, moisture fluctuations, poor construction, or natural settling over time. Symptoms may include visible cracks in walls or floors, doors and windows that no longer close properly, or uneven surfaces. Left unaddressed, foundation issues can lead to more extensive structural damage, increased repair costs, and safety concerns. Repair services aim to correct these issues early, providing a more stable base for the building and helping to prevent future complications.
These services are commonly utilized for residential properties, including single-family homes and multi-family dwellings, as well as commercial buildings such as office complexes and retail spaces. Older properties are particularly susceptible to foundation problems due to age-related settling or outdated construction methods. Additionally, areas with expansive or shifting soils tend to see higher demand for foundation repair services, as these conditions can accelerate foundation movement and damage.

Foundation Damage Repair Costs - Typical expenses for fixing foundation damage can range from $2,000 to $7,000, depending on the extent of the issues. Minor repairs might be closer to the lower end, while more extensive work can approach higher figures.
Foundation Crack Repairs - Repairing cracks in a foundation generally costs between $500 and $3,000. Smaller cracks may be less costly, whereas larger or multiple cracks can increase the overall expense.
Structural Reinforcement Expenses - Reinforcing a foundation to ensure stability usually falls within the $3,000 to $10,000 range. The cost varies based on the size of the property and the severity of the damage.
Cost Factors - The total cost for foundation damage repair depends on factors such as soil conditions, foundation type, and the extent of structural issues. Local service providers can offer estimates tailored to specific situations in Beachwood, OH.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of foundation damage? Indicators include uneven floors, cracks in walls or ceilings, sticking doors or windows, and visible cracks in the foundation itself.
How is foundation damage typically repaired? Repairs often involve methods such as underpinning, piering, or sealing cracks, which are performed by local foundation specialists.
Can foundation damage be prevented? Proper drainage, maintaining soil stability around the property, and addressing minor issues early can help reduce the risk of significant foundation problems.
What should I do if I notice foundation cracks? Contact a local foundation repair professional to assess the damage and determine the appropriate repair solution.
How long do foundation repairs usually take? The duration depends on the extent of the damage and the chosen repair method, with most projects completed within a few days to a week.
